I'm just going to say this now, as I think it's super effective.

We need to run a few Dethy games for the sake of bringing the veterans back to logic, and showing some of the newer players how logic can win games. Dethy is one cop of each flavor:

Sane - Accurate Investigations
Insane - Opposite Investigations
Paranoid - Always Guilty
Naive - Always Innocent

And one mafia. Each night the cops investigate and share results the next day. Mafia has to fake it to blend in. Logic dictates who is who through process of elimination. The only FUD is usually at the end for LoL purposes if the mafia has completely mirrored one cop, and someone has to choose which one is telling the truth.

Notes isn't the right word. More like a chart.

_____N1 N2 N3 N4
Kris
Arch
drew
Ant
Dez

Investigation results go in the blanks.

Then you chart whether or not someone is whatever type of cop, till you narrow it down to 2 that are the same, and try to pick the right one. Or mafia gets trapped in the logic and it's even easier.
